What You’ll Do / Key Responsibilities

As our Landscape Account Manager, you will step onto a massive, premier 1,200-acre commercial manufacturing facility and take complete operational ownership. In this dynamic, high-impact role, you will act as a hands-on commercial landscape manager, driving exceptional quality control, executing contract fulfillment, and ensuring absolute client satisfaction across the property.

Lead & Scale Operations

  • Initially oversee and hold accountable 9 subcontract personnel
  • eventually build infrastructure and hire a brand-new 5-to-6-person internal site crew
  • Supervise, train, and conduct performance reviews for field personnel

Zone Management & Field Execution

  • Strategically break down a 300+ active acre property (turf, parking lots, ponds) into highly organized operational zones
  • Cook daily schedules, assign crews, manage tool/supply inventories, and review Quality Control Reports

Quality Assurance & Safety

  • Act as the primary landscape operations manager on-site, conducting routine inspections to identify details (weeds, turf health, pests) and diagnose basic equipment maintenance needs
  • Track employee attendance and enforce safety regulations

Client Relations & Enhancements

  • Meet regularly with site stakeholders to ensure work orders are completed efficiently
  • Proactively identify, propose, and oversee profitable site enhancement opportunities to drive personal and branch sales goals

What You Bring To The Team / Qualifications

  • Experience: Minimum of a 2-year degree or 3+ years of progressive supervisory experience in the commercial landscape maintenance field
  • Operational Mindset: Highly organized with a "working manager" approach—comfortable operating heavy equipment (spraying, bushhogging) alongside the crew when necessary and troubleshooting basic machinery
  • Communication & Tech Skills: Solid verbal and written communication skills to deliver professional client updates, write simple correspondence, and utilize a company phone/laptop
  • Licenses: Must possess a valid Driver's License with a driving record that meets company standards. A valid NC Pesticide License is highly preferred (or willingness to operate under our branch license)
  • Physical Stamina: Able to work outdoors in changing weather conditions, stand/walk for extended periods, and regularly lift/move up to 50 pounds (and occasionally up to 100 pounds)
  • Reliability: Complete schedule flexibility to ensure a sharp 6:00 AM arrival to open the shop and launch crews successfully
